package com.wlami.mibox.core.encryption;

import org.bouncycastle.crypto.PBEParametersGenerator;
import org.bouncycastle.crypto.generators.PKCS5S2ParametersGenerator;
import org.bouncycastle.crypto.params.KeyParameter;

/**
 * This class provides methods for key derivation from passwords.
 */
public class PBKDF2 {

    /** Default key length in bit */
    private static final int DEFAULT_KEY_LENGTH_BIT = 256;

    /** PBKDF2 uses this number of rounds for key derivation */
    private static final int DEFAULT_KEY_TRANSFORMATION_ROUNDS = 10000;

    /** hidden constructor because this is an utility class */
    private PBKDF2() {
    }

    protected static byte[] doPbkdf2(String password, String salt, int rounds) {
        PBEParametersGenerator pbeParametersGenerator = new PKCS5S2ParametersGenerator();
        pbeParametersGenerator.init(PBEParametersGenerator.PKCS5PasswordToBytes(password.toCharArray()),
                PBEParametersGenerator.PKCS5PasswordToBytes(salt.toCharArray()), rounds);
        KeyParameter keyParameter = (KeyParameter) pbeParametersGenerator
                .generateDerivedParameters(DEFAULT_KEY_LENGTH_BIT);
        return keyParameter.getKey();
    }

    /**
     * Get an 256bit key from a given password. This key can be used for aes
     * encryption.
     * 
     * @param password
     *            The password from which the key is derived
     * @param salt
     *            salt value
     * @return returns an byte array with length 32;
     */
    public static byte[] getKeyFromPasswordAndSalt(String password, String salt) {
        return doPbkdf2(password, salt, DEFAULT_KEY_TRANSFORMATION_ROUNDS);
    }

}
